#6 Spilling CID

Lasting Damage

Sophie Hannah

It's 1.15 a.m. and Connie Bowskill should be asleep. Instead, she's logging on to a property website in search of a particular house: 11 Bentley Grove, Cambridge. She knows it's for sale - there's an estate agent's board in the front garden. Soon Connie is clicking on the 'Virtual Tour' button, keen to see the inside of the house and put her mind at rest once and for all. She finds herself looking at a scene from a nightmare: in the living room, in the middle of the carpet, lies a woman face down in a pool of blood. In shock, Connie wakes her husband Kit. But when Kit sits down at the computer, he sees no dead body, only a pristine beige carpet in a perfectly ordinary room... (In the USA, the title of this book is "The Other Woman's House")
